Why Yuba City changes the equation
Yuba City is a strong market for domestic solar since it gets plenty of sunlight and sees significant summer cooling demand. When triple-digit temperatures resolve in, electrical costs can climb fast. That makes solar eye-catching, however it also means the information of system sizing come to be more crucial. A family that runs a/c hard from June with September has an extremely different usage account from a home with mild need year-round.
Local climate also impacts devices selections. Panels on a warm roof do not create at their lab-rated top, so realistic production price quotes issue. Installers that recognize the area will certainly make up warmth losses, orientation, and seasonal consumption rather than swing around idyllic numbers. This is where experienced solar providers tend to divide themselves from hostile sales operations.
Yuba City home owners additionally need to think almost regarding roof covering design and age. Many homes in the area have uncomplicated roof covering designs that are friendly to solar, however not all do. Vents, hips, valleys, second-story areas, and tree color can minimize useful room. If a service provider provides you a quote without a meaningful website evaluation, that is an indication. Good layout begins with the real roof covering, not a common template.
Start with your residence, not the sales pitch
The best way to contrast solar panel providers is to recognize your own home prior to the propositions start showing up. Pull your last year of electrical costs. Look at total annual kilowatt-hour use, however additionally see the heights. If your summer season bills are a lot higher than winter months, mention that early. If you recently purchased an EV, changed your HVAC system, or strategy to construct a pool, that transforms the design conversation.
It also helps to be truthful regarding your time perspective. If you anticipate to move in three years, funding and repayment must be reviewed in different ways than if this is your lasting home. If your roof has much less than 10 years of life left, solar might still make good sense, but the installation technique must resolve future reroofing costs.
A service provider who is worth your focus will request for those details. If they do not, they are probably selling a settlement, not a system.

The proposition need to make good sense on paper
A tidy proposition is frequently the easiest way to judge expertise. You should be able to comprehend system size, estimated yearly manufacturing, devices version names, financing terms if appropriate, and any assumptions used in the cost savings quote. If the installer can not clarify the math, the proposition is not ready.
Be mindful with extra-large cost savings insurance claims. Production price quotes can vary based upon software, shielding presumptions, roof azimuth, and local weather information, yet they must still remain within a believable variety. If one bid jobs considerably higher output from the very same roofing making use of comparable tools, ask why. Perhaps they used optimizers while the others did not. Perhaps they modeled much less shade. Or possibly they just cushioned the numbers to make the repayment appearance better.
This is likewise where house owners obtain tripped up by low monthly settlement deals. A reduced repayment can hide a longer loan term, a higher dealer fee, or a greater overall task cost. Month-to-month cost issues, naturally, but it needs to never be the only number you compare.

Price issues, however cost per watt matters more
Many property owners contrast quotes by checking out overall task expense. That is a begin, but insufficient. A better comparison uses cost per watt, which helps stabilize systems of different dimensions. If one firm prices estimate a 6.4 kW system and another quotes 7.1 kW, the larger complete price may still be the better value.
Even then, rate per watt should not be dealt with as the only scoring statistics. Devices top quality, roof covering intricacy, guarantee terms, and installer online reputation all influence value. A company that is available in a little bit greater yet includes more powerful workmanship coverage and cleaner design may conserve you cash and worry over time.
For property systems in California, prices can vary extensively based on financing, battery inclusion, roofing system gain access to, and service panel conditions. That is why wide internet standards are just rough referral factors. Use them to flag outliers, not to decide for you.
A really low bid deserves careful analysis. In some cases it is a real bargain from an effective installer. Various other times it suggests corners are being cut in project monitoring, labor top quality, or post-install solution. Inexpensive solar can end up being costly when leaks, electrical wiring problems, or sluggish service go into the picture.
Equipment options are not all equal
Homeowners do not need to end up being solar designers, however they should understand the basic equipment groups. Panels matter, though most major brand names marketed today are reasonably capable if correctly mounted. The larger differentiator is typically the inverter design and the quality of system design.
String inverter systems can be affordable and basic, particularly on roof coverings with consistent sun direct exposure. Microinverters or optimizers might make even more feeling on roof coverings with multiple alignments or partial shade. There is no single best setup for every single house. The appropriate solar providers will certainly clarify why they chose a style, not just name-drop brands.
Battery discussions are entitled to comparable treatment. Some sales groups push storage space whether it fits or otherwise. A battery can provide backup power and boost resilience, but it adds substantial expense. For some homes, especially those concerned about interruptions or time-of-use exposure, it can be worthwhile. For others, beginning with solar alone and preparing for future storage space is the far better move. A thoughtful installer will certainly go over that trade-off plainly.
Financing is entitled to as much analysis as the hardware
This is where numerous solar offers go sideways. Home owners concentrate on panels, then authorize finance documentation they barely evaluated. Solar funding can function well, however just if you understand truth cost.
Cash acquisitions typically offer the clearest economics if you can manage them. Financings can protect liquidity, but terms vary extensively. Leases and power purchase contracts can reduce upfront cost, yet they additionally make complex home resale and change much of the lasting upside away from the property owner. That does not make them instantly bad, however it does make them something to check out carefully.
When comparing solar companies, request for the cash rate also if you mean to finance. That single number assists you see just how much financing is contributing to the job. Some homeowners are amazed to discover that two comparable monthly settlement offers can stand for really various system prices underneath.
Also take note of what occurs if you sell your house. Can the car loan be moved conveniently? Does the purchaser demand to qualify? Are there early repayment penalties? Those are not side questions. In some deals, they become the major issue.
Service after installment is where reputations are earned
Most systems enter without major drama. The actual examination comes later on. Tracking quits coverage. An inverter goes offline. You need roof covering work and want support on panel elimination and reinstall. This is the component of the experience most sales presentations hardly touch.
Ask how solution requests are taken care of. Ask whether the firm has in-house technicians. Ask about ordinary reaction time. When possible, check out reviews that discuss post-install assistance, not just sales experience. A business can gain 5 star for smooth organizing and still dissatisfy terribly when a problem turns up 18 months later.
I have seen home owners select in between 2 comparable quotes and be sorry for choosing the firm that was just a little more affordable because assistance came to be almost impossible to get to. On an item expected to last decades, responsiveness is not a high-end attribute. It is part of the value.

Watch for these functional caution signs
Some red flags are subtle, others are noticeable. Both issue. When property owners browse solar companies near me, they usually run into the exact same patterns.
A rushed close is one of the clearest signs. If the representative urges motivations are disappearing tomorrow, confirm independently. Plans do change, but high-pressure countdown strategies prevail. An additional cautioning sign is a quote supplied before any meaningful consider your roof, panel, or use background. Excellent solar layout is not guesswork.
Be unconvinced of assurances that sound too broad. "Your expense will disappear" is not an accountable guarantee. Energy minimum costs, seasonal variant, and family use adjustments all impact outcomes. Similarly, if a company sweep aside roofing system problem, tree growth, or panel upgrades as small information, they are ignoring real task constraints.
One much more care is inconsistent paperwork. If the salesperson states something however the composed proposition claims another, depend on the documentation and push for explanation prior to signing. Spoken guarantees do not age well.

How much do solar providers charge for installation in Yuba City?
Solar installation typically costs between $15,000 and $35,000 before incentives for most residential systems. Pricing depends on system size, equipment quality, roof characteristics, and labor requirements. Larger systems designed to offset greater energy consumption generally cost more. Available incentives may reduce the total cost.

How long does solar installation take in Yuba City?
The physical installation process usually takes one to three days for a residential system. However, the complete project timeline, including design, permitting, inspections, and utility approval, often takes several weeks. Local requirements and project complexity can affect scheduling. Larger systems may require additional time.
